This book introduces a number of ideas in differential geometry centred around recent work on isoparametric submanifolds. After an initial introduction to the geometry of submanifolds, the author discusses the idea of focal points and principal curvatures. The topic is treated from a totally new geometric point of view where the geometry of the set of critical normals is taken as a way of discussing relations between the principal curvatures. Recent work on holonomy group of the normal bundle of a submanifold due to Thorbergsson, Olmos, Heintze and others are described. The examples of isoparametric submanifolds due to Ferus, Karcher and Munzner is considered in some detail.

Submanifolds of IR to the power of n; tangent fields; normal fields; covariant differentiation; Gauss-Codazzi equations; parallel submanifolds in IR to the power of n; relations between the shape operators; holonomy groups; normal holonomy groups; manifolds with flat normal bundle; isoparametric systems and their basic properties; an homogeneous example; isotropy representations; the Ferus-Karcher-Munzner examples; focal manifolds of isoparametric systems; Strubing's condition; Tits buildings and isoparametric submanifolds.
